At the heart of the Small Semiconductor Heater lies advanced semiconductor technology, leveraging the unique properties of semiconductor materials to generate heat. Unlike traditional heating elements, which rely on resistance heating, semiconductor heaters employ the Peltier effect, a phenomenon where a current passing through the semiconductor junction causes heat to be either absorbed or emitted depending on the direction of the current flow. This fascinating principle allows these heaters to deliver precise and adjustable heating capabilities, tailored to the specific needs of the user.

Furthermore, the Small Semiconductor Heater's ability to provide both heating and cooling functionalities sets it apart from traditional heaters. By reversing the direction of the current flow through the semiconductor junction, these heaters can function as coolers, allowing for precise temperature regulation in both directions. This dual functionality expands its applications to cooling sensitive electronic components, maintaining a stable temperature for delicate instruments, and creating comfortable microclimates in extreme weather conditions.
